Car Rental in Spain is Mainly Not the Same
Wednesday 30 April 2008 @ 8:08 am

In a nation like the United States, where icons like McDonald’s
and Wal-Mart have spoiled us into thinking we can go anywhere we
like and still get a quarter pounder with cheese - or find
people wearing blue smocks - it can be easy to think that the
world is all the same. Even the car rental game seems the same,
because we can get off at any airport and choose between
compact, mid-size, or full-size, and generally get what we want
and expect. While we may not want to admit it, the rest of the
world just does not operate according to our way of thinking.

Getting a car rental in Spain, for instance, may not be
difficult, but it certainly is not the same as securing one in
Cleveland. There are some subtle differences between a car
rental agency in Europe and one in America. If you plan on
traveling abroad, don’t expect everything to be exactly the same.

So what can I expect when I want a car rental in Spain?

For one thing, don’t expect a great selection of vehicles with
automatic transmissions or air conditioning. A car rental place
in Spain, or elsewhere in Europe, will usually have only a
limited selection of vehicles with these customary American
options. Plus, while a car rental place in the United States
will charge you an insane fee for not filling the fuel tank
before returning, this pales by comparison to what may happen in
Europe. Not only will you pay a steeper price for returning to
the car rental company on “E”, but you will have to pay for gas
by the liter - and the cost could break the bank for you.

In fact, because of the steep gasoline prices in Europe, you may
want to ask the car rental agency for a diesel-powered car, as
this will be easier on your budget. This may not measure up the
exotic dreams you had for your time in Europe, but your wallet
will thank you for making the more conservative choice at the
car rental agency.

Will I have problems actually renting a car?

That depends on what you mean. Some nations require an
international driving license, and the car rental agencies in
these countries are required to ask this of anyone renting a
car. To be on the safe side, you might want to go to a place
like the American Automobile Association to avoid an
embarrassing scene at the car rental place in Spain. It’s up to
you, of course, but “better safe than sorry” is a good way to go
here.

Now, because Europe is such a popular tourist destination in the
summer, you might be very disappointed when the car rental agent
in Spain shakes her head and tells you that nothing is
available. It is best to reserve your vehicle as far in advance
as possible, especially if you hope to have any luck at the car
rental places during the peak periods.

What else should I know?

While not necessary, you may want to opt for the insurance at
the car rental place. The reason? Europeans are known to be more
aggressive drivers than their American counterparts. This is not
to say that they are worse drivers, but their aggressive
maneuvers may take you off guard. And you don’t want to return
to the car rental agency and have them charge your insurance
company for your European driving lesson, do you? I didn’t think
so.

So take these guidelines into account when securing a car rental
in Europe, and they will provide for a much more enjoyable and
hassle-free experience. And when you get there, say “Hi” to the
Eiffel Tower for me.

Using the Sun to Power Your RV
Wednesday 30 April 2008 @ 6:38 am

Jumping in your RV and leaving the rat race for the weekend is
an American tradition. Did you know you can provide power to
your RV with the sun while getting away from it all?

The Sun is Everywhere!

One of the biggest misconceptions regarding solar power is that
it is limited to large panel systems on roofs. Au contraire!
With new nanotechnology, solar power systems will soon be
applied with the paint you use to improve your home. That’s
still two or three years away, so what about now?

If you enjoy taking the RV out for an excursion, you can use
solar power to provide your electrical needs. Whether you are
going camping or to a NASCAR race, it is an exceedingly simple
process.

Unlike homes, RVs run on direct current electricity. This makes
them perfect for solar electricity since solar systems produce
direct current electricity instead of alternating current. Put
another way, there is no need for bulky converters to flip the
electricity from direct to alternating. Instead, you can use the
sun to power up your batteries directly.

Portable solar systems consist of pop-up solar modules with four
or five panels. Essentially, they look like small ladders with
solar panels instead of steps. You just pop them up on the roof
of the RV or in an area where the sun hits them. The systems tie
directly into your batteries and power them up during the day.
Super easy and super clean.

The real advantage to solar RV systems has to do with noise. The
traditional method for recharging your RV batteries is to turn
on a generator and generators can be very loud. Even the
quietest generator makes enough noise to make you feel like you
live next to a construction site. Solar systems make no noise at
all. There are no moving parts, just the sun beating down on the
panels. You’ll never know they are even there.

If RVing is your thing, portable solar modules are worth taking
a look at. With high fuel prices, you need to save a buck
wherever you can.

Ordinary Objects? Or Listening Devices?
Tuesday 29 April 2008 @ 4:08 pm

Listening devices are among the most basic of spy and surveillance equipment. It is the first thing that any professional, amateur, or hobbyist should look into getting. There is a wide variety of listening devices. They range from the large-seeming constructs that are pointed at subjects up to 300 yards away and still pick up sound, to tiny RF transmitters that hide among telephone cords. But the most interesting bugging devices are those that look like ordinary, everyday objects. They are fun to use and often lull unsuspecting subjects into a false sense of security, encouraging them to reveal information that they do not want you to have.

Listening devices that look like everyday items are especially helpful if you want to record a conversation you are having with someone, but don’t want them to know you are recording it, or if you want to listen in on a conversation someone is having in another room (one that she or he would not have with you present). You can leave the object behind, and the person will not know that you are listening, or you can wear the bug on your person, sending the audio to a recorder that you can further listen to at a later time.

Some of the more common everyday listening devices are things like pens and cell phones. These are items that are prevalent everywhere. It does not look suspicious if you have a pen in your pocket, or use it to take notes. Likewise, nobody thinks twice about the cell phone hanging from a clip on your belt. These are objects that people expect to accompany you everywhere. And they are also objects that nobody suspects when you “forget” them. People are forever misplacing pens and cell phones.

Other listening devices that masquerade as regular items include reading glasses, makeup compacts, and even larger, more stationary things like clocks and small sculptures. It is even possible to hide bugs in innocuous objects not likely to be suspected of containing bugs. Many of these things still perform their normal functions, so they work as they should. They just have the added bonus of actually being listening devices.

Thyroid 101 what you need to know about
Monday 28 April 2008 @ 6:25 pm

Amongst the various medical problems on a rise, thyroid sure is
amongst the top few. Thyroid problems are becoming more common
in the present society with every passing day. Major causes of
the problem are improper nutrition and lack of nutrients in the
soil. To understand the effects of thyroid malfunctioning, it’s
important to understand what exactly the gland des in the body.
Thyroid is a small butterfly shaped gland located directly below
the Adam’s apple. This gland swells up accompanied by an
inflammatory sensation, when not working properly. This can be
seen as a small bulge in the area. Doctors might feel the size
of the gland by keeping hand around your neck and making you
swallow.

Thyroid is known as the hormone factory of the body, as it
manufactures a number of hormones for the body. T3 and T4 are
the major hormones amongst them. Among various other things
these hormones control the body’s metabolism and energy levels.
Body fails to function properly in case of excess or lack of
these hormones. While lack of these hormones make the body
sluggish and slow an excess of these make the person hyper
active sending the body in an overdrive.

Thyroid has to be taken care of properly as it affects the
entire body. Damage to thyroid ends up effecting entire body
over a period of time. Brain might be effected in terms of
memory loss and moodiness, reproductive health, heart, body
weight etc are some matters that can occur with thyroid
disorders.

Thyroid malfunctioning more often then not leads to heart
problems and a number of other problems as well. Often a part of
auto immune problems, thyroid can go simultaneously with
cholesterol and other problems. Body may experience arthritis
type pain which shall diminish as soon as the hormone levels are
back to normal.

Thyroid problems affect irrespective of age and sex. According
to the American Thyroid Association, half of the people with
thyroid problems do not even know about it. It often goes
unnoticed as the symptoms are mistaken as that of some other
disease. For eg tiredness is a major symptom but is generally
overlooked as a general feeling or is associated to other health
problems.

However certain groups of people are more susceptible to the
disease then others. For eg women are 8 times more likely then
men to face the disorder. You are also more prone if you have a
family history of the autoimmune diseases. In such a case
regular checkup of the thyroid gland is highly recommended.

People with a high exposure to radiation also have higher
chances of a thyroid disorder as the gland is sensitive to any
radiation. Similarly elderly people amongst us also run a higher
risk of disorder.

Being a victim of thyroid disorder can be a sad story and at
times really discouraging. Symptoms can be painful and tend to
pull you sown. However the facts remain that you can live with
it, and live happily at that.

First step is getting the right treatment. Contacting the right
doctor and taking the full course of treatment. Being proactive
is also very important and if medications don’t prove effective,
then tell your doctor immediately. Another important thing is
eating healthy. Sugar rich and processed foods should be
avoided. Most importantly, help someone else. It’s rarely
prescribed by doctors, but is in fact an excellent antidote, for
many ailments.

How to backup your data properly
Monday 28 April 2008 @ 4:52 pm

Your data is important to you and why shouldn’t it be. Computers
have grown to be a part of our daily lives, so it’s safe to say
that most of us would be devastated if we lost everything on our
computer. That is kind of a scary thought as your data depends
on a machine to keep and store it, and let’s face it, machines
fail. Although computers have become much more reliable, more
complex software and the internet has made everyone’s computer
vulnerable to complete loss of data.

There is something you can do to fight back though, that is to
take matters into your own hands and don’t rely solely on your
computer. The best way to do this is to backup your data
properly and keep doing that at least once a week, or once a
day, depending on the type of data that you are backing up. This
is perhaps the most important task that any computer owner can
do, and is the simplest, but yet not everyone does it.

On the computer market these days there are a slew of external
and internal storage devices that make backing up your data easy
and convenient. With so many devices, and so many solutions, it
can be tough for someone to decide on a backup method. So let’s
talk about the different backup strategies you could implement
and which one best suits your needs.

Known worldwide basically as the main method of backing up your
data is your floppy disc drive. I know they store a very little
amount of data, but for simple data files it’s perfect because
every computer already has one, and it is easy to use and
access. I thought I would remind everyone of that backup method
because it still can be used and won’t cost you anything more.

Now if you want to get down and serious, and backup everything
on your computer, then what you want to do is a full hard disk
backup. A full hard disk backup is what every computer users
should do, and is perhaps one of the best data backup solutions
possible. This is true because it makes a full copy of your hard
drive, so if all data is lost then your backup could be used
immediately and will have everything on it. The only problem
with this backup strategy is that it takes a little while to
complete the backup, and to get the best use out of it, you
should do it once a week. But if your data is really that
important, then it is worth the time and energy to do this.

The next backup solution is pretty common and has already been
done by just about everyone. You could just backup your data
files and folders that are important to you, so if you ever lose
all of your data, then you would still have your important files
and only have to reinstall the software associated with them, if
any. Files and folders are usually the most important type of
data that someone needs to back up and is all that matters, so
most of you should use this method.

Perhaps the best backup solution there is, next to a full hard
disk backup, is a CD or DVD burner. Now since both of those
burners cost around the same price, DVD is just a little more,
then I recommend a DVD burner. Not only does DVD technology hold
more then four times as much data as a regular CD, but a DVD
burner will also burn regular CD’s. Also not to mention that
fact that you can backup your home movies that then can be
played in your DVD player, and can last forever without
degrading in quality like VHS.

Well those are the main types of backup strategies and solutions
that people are using these days. Whether you run a business on
your computer, or just use it for fun, backing up your data is
always a good idea and should never be overlooked by any
computer user.
